概述
1.项目运行流程(规则)
思考:cnpm run serve干了啥
1 去package.json的scripts键中找serve键 2 去运行src/main.js(整个项目入口文件 3 入口文件核心的代码 new Vue el:"#app" 默认显示App组件数据 4 然后切记App组件挖坑显示 路由匹配的组件数据
思考:浏览器输入/或/about干了啥
1 根据浏览器【请求路径】去【src/router/index.js】中匹配 2 匹配不到-坑不显示,匹配到了-获取组件数据放到坑里面 3 最后渲染
2.vue.config.js配置 -修改配置文件得重启服务
别名
const path = require('path');
module.exports = {
configureWebpack: {
resolve: {
alias: {
'@': path.resolve(__dirname, 'src'),
'~': path.resolve(__dirname, 'src'),
'style': path.resolve(__dirname, 'src/style')
}
}
}
};
跨域
const path = require('path');
module.exports = {
devServer: {
proxy: {
'/api任意名称': {
//将真实请求网址用api替换
target: '真实请求网址',
changeOrigin: true, // 是否允许跨域
secure: false,
// 关闭SSL证书验证https协议接口需要改成true
pathRewrite: {
// 重写路径请求
'^/api任意名称': '' //路径重写
路径前面带有api,即不需要api,将api去掉
}
},
}
}
}
// 步骤1:【仅一次】vue.config.js 随意起一个任意名称,普遍是/api
// 步骤2:【仅一次】vue.config.js 写真实网址
// 步骤3:【仅一次】vue.config.js 查看接口文档有没有【任意名称这里写/api就是/api】是否要去掉
// 步骤4:【仅一次】重启服务
// 步骤5:【N次】 views fetch/axios里面的【真实网址】改成【/api】
最后
以上就是迷路汽车为你收集整理的项目运行初始配置的全部内容,希望文章能够帮你解决项目运行初始配置所遇到的程序开发问题。
如果觉得靠谱客网站的内容还不错,欢迎将靠谱客网站推荐给程序员好友。
本图文内容来源于网友提供,作为学习参考使用,或来自网络收集整理,版权属于原作者所有。
发表评论 取消回复